"Movement really is one of the key factors in teaching people to breathe better or breathe correctly." - Katie Crane In this episode, we dive deep into the Pilates principle of breath. Breathing is such a fundamental aspect of our lives, and it plays a crucial role in our Pilates practice as well. In this episode, we explore the physiology of breathing, how it affects our energy levels, and the mechanics of breathing during movement. We also discuss the importance of breath in facilitating the connection of our deep core muscles. I believe that movement is one of the key factors in teaching people to breathe better. By incorporating movement into our practice, we can improve our breath and enhance our overall well-being. I share my insights on how to approach breath in Pilates and offer tips on when to focus on breath during exercises. But that's not all! In this episode, I also touch on the other Pilates principles we've covered so far, including centering, concentration, control, and precision. These principles work together to create a holistic Pilates experience that benefits the mind, body, and soul.
